TASMANIA’S potato growers are relieved to have negotiated an increase in the base price from major processor Simplot for the upcoming season but say costs are going up. Tasmanian Farmers and Graziers Association Simplot potato grower committee chairman, Trevor Hall, said yesterday that growers had accepted a rise of $20 a tonne on the base price and were eligible for size and quality bonuses. “The increase is pretty good, and to my knowledge the second highest ever in Tasmania, but it is needed to cover increasing input costs,” Mr Hall said.
